[kdevelop] [Bug 386345] New: There is no simple way how to focus/highlight/select currently edited file in the "Projects" toolview
https://bugs.kde.org/show_bug.cgi?id=386345 Bug ID: 386345 Summary: There is no simple way how to focus/highlight/select currently edited file in the "Projects" toolview Product: kdevelop Version: 5.1.2 Platform: Neon Packages OS: Linux Status: UNCONFIRMED Severity: normal Priority: NOR Component: UI: general Assignee: kdevelop-bugs-n...@kde.org Reporter: vbs...@centrum.cz Target Milestone: --- This is feature request, not a bug. I did not find suitable place for feature request. Feature request: "Focus/highlight/select currently edited file in the project view." Current state: There is no simple way how to focus/highlight/select currently* edited file in the "Projects" toolview"(*or any file opened in the editor tab). Business requirement: The user shall be able to quickly find currently opened or edited file in the "Projects" toolview in order to get context of the file. The immediate action "Select in projects view" should be accessible: - from editor context menu, - from editor tab context menu, - have the possibility to bind to user defined "shortcut". User story: - Bob opens large project - Bob will start build of the project - There are multiple errors in CMakeList.txt files, which Bob opens by clicking on the error messages showed in the "Build" toolview. - Bob finds that there are so many CMakeList.txt files opened in the editor - Bob wants to identify context of actually opened file - Bob press "Ctrl+Alt+P" and get the current file highlighted/selected in the "Projects" toolview. Notes: The shortcut "Ctrl+Alt+P" is just example/placeholder for more appropriate shortcut. Instead using the shortcut, Bob may want to use particular context menu. Alternatively if the file is not part of any project, the file may be highlighted in the Filesystem toolview. -- You are receiving this mail because: You are watching all bug changes.

[plasmashell] [Bug 385799] New: Icons-Only Task Manager - Behavior of pined application changed to strange icon re-positioning when application started.
https://bugs.kde.org/show_bug.cgi?id=385799 Bug ID: 385799 Summary: Icons-Only Task Manager - Behavior of pined application changed to strange icon re-positioning when application started. Product: plasmashell Version: 5.11.0 Platform: Other OS: Linux Status: UNCONFIRMED Severity: normal Priority: NOR Component: Icons-only Task Manager Assignee: h...@kde.org Reporter: vbs...@centrum.cz CC: plasma-b...@kde.org Target Milestone: 1.0 Created attachment 108370 --> https://bugs.kde.org/attachment.cgi?id=108370=edit Icons-Only-Task-Manage-Weird-Behavior Icons-Only Task Manager (next IOTM) - Behavior of pined application changed to strange icon re-positioning when application started. How to reproduce: 1. Have a clear panel. 2. Add IOTM on it. 3. Run and pin any two applications on the panel. Close both applications. 4. Click on the most left pinned application in order to run it. What happens? The icon (most left) of the application will move (re-position) to the most right side of the IOTM. What is expected? The icon of the pinned started application should stay where it was/is and should just indicate the application is/was starting/started. Observations: It worked well in 5.10 and lower. Id stop working in 5.11. I am using KDE Neon stable repositories. With the Plasma 5.10 everything worked well as one would expect. With the 5.11 it changed to this weird behavior. My users who accidentally confirmed the update are screaming every morning what is happening with their apps (I know the icon is just nearby but they do not care). For illustration please see attached screen recording. -- You are receiving this mail because: You are watching all bug changes.
